Factors to Consider When Choosing a Portable Butane Stove

portable butane stove factors

When selecting a portable butane stove, it's essential to take into account key selection factors, ensuring you choose the right one for your needs. Safety and reliability are paramount, so look for stoves with built-in safety features and a reputation for durability.

Portability considerations, fuel efficiency tips, and cooking versatility should also guide your decision-making process for a successful camping experience.

Key Selection Factors

Taking into account various factors when selecting a portable butane stove is essential for meeting your camping cooking needs effectively.

First, verify the heat output, measured in BTUs, matches your cooking requirements. Safety features such as automatic ignition, pressure sensors, and shut-off mechanisms are vital for peace of mind.

Portability is key, so check the weight, size, and included carrying case for easy transportation to and from your campsite. Evaluate fuel compatibility with both butane and propane options for flexibility in fuel sources.

Lastly, read user reviews to gauge reliability, durability, ease of use, and performance in different conditions. By considering these key selection factors, you can choose a portable butane stove that best suits your outdoor culinary adventures.

Safety and Reliability

Prioritizing safety and reliability when selecting a portable butane stove for camping, outdoor cooking, or emergency use is vital for ensuring a worry-free cooking experience. Look for stoves equipped with safety features like automatic shut-off mechanisms and pressure sensors to guarantee safe operation. Consider the reliability of the ignition system, such as piezo-electric starters, for easy and consistent lighting.

It's important to check for certifications like CSA approval for gas appliances to make sure safety and quality standards are met. Additionally, ensure the stove has stable construction and design features like wind guards to prevent accidents in outdoor conditions. By focusing on safety and reliability, you can enjoy your outdoor cooking adventures with peace of mind.

Portability Considerations

Taking into account the weight and dimensions of a portable butane stove is crucial for guaranteeing convenient storage and easy transportation during outdoor activities like camping, hiking, and picnics. When choosing a portable stove, consider its weight to make sure it can be comfortably carried in a backpack or camping gear.

Look for compact designs that won't take up too much space but still offer enough cooking area. Features like a carrying case or handle can enhance portability, making it easier to move the stove from one location to another.

The portability of the stove impacts its versatility and convenience for various cooking needs, so selecting one that's easy to transport can make your outdoor adventures more enjoyable and hassle-free.

Fuel Efficiency Tips

To maximize fuel efficiency when selecting a portable butane stove, prioritize the use of high-quality butane fuel canisters. By choosing reputable fuel canisters, you guarantee peak burning efficiency, which can extend your cooking time.

Additionally, keeping your stove clean and well-maintained is vital for improving fuel efficiency. Adjusting the flame to the appropriate level for your cooking task not only helps conserve fuel but also ensures even cooking.

Proper ventilation is essential to prevent carbon monoxide build-up and maximize fuel efficiency. Consider using a wind guard to shield the flame from gusts of wind, preventing heat loss and maintaining efficient fuel burning.

These simple tips can make a significant difference in how efficiently your portable butane stove consumes fuel during your outdoor adventures.

Cooking Versatility Guide

When selecting a portable butane stove for outdoor adventures, consider the cooking versatility it offers to meet a range of culinary needs. Portable butane stoves are ideal for camping, hiking, and picnicking, providing a convenient cooking solution in various outdoor settings. These stoves boast high heat outputs and adjustable flame controls, allowing for tasks like boiling water or simmering dishes.

Some models even support both butane and propane fuels, offering flexibility for different cooking durations. Their compact and lightweight design makes them easy to transport and set up, enhancing the overall outdoor cooking experience. Whether you're facing an emergency or simply enjoying the great outdoors, a portable butane stove's cooking versatility guarantees you can whip up delicious meals wherever you go.

Maintenance Essentials

Regularly cleaning the stove and burner components is important to prevent clogs and promote efficient fuel combustion. It's necessary to check and replace any damaged or worn-out parts like O-rings or seals to guarantee safe operation.

Storing the stove in a dry, well-ventilated area helps prevent rust and corrosion, extending its lifespan. Before each use, inspect the fuel canisters for leaks or damage to avoid potential accidents.

Following the manufacturer's instructions for proper maintenance and care is critical for keeping your portable butane stove in top condition. By adopting these maintenance practices, you'll not only enhance the stove's performance but also prioritize safety during your outdoor adventures.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can These Portable Butane Stoves Be Used Indoors Safely?

Yes, portable butane stoves can be used indoors safely, but with caution. Guarantee proper ventilation to prevent carbon monoxide build-up. Avoid using them in confined spaces to reduce fire risks. Always follow the manufacturer's guidelines for safe indoor use.

Regularly check for gas leaks and keep a fire extinguisher nearby as a precaution. By taking these precautions, you can enjoy cooking indoors with your portable butane stove safely.

Are These Stoves Compatible With Different Sizes of Cookware?

Certainly, these stoves can handle various cookware sizes. The key is to make sure the cookware's base fits securely on the stove's burners for efficient heating. Look for stoves with sturdy support and adjustable grates to accommodate different pot and pan sizes.

This versatility allows us to cook a range of meals while camping or enjoying outdoor adventures. Compatibility with various cookware sizes enhances our cooking experience and makes meal preparation a breeze.

How Long Does a Butane Canister Typically Last During Cooking?

Typically, a butane canister lasts around 1 to 3 hours during cooking, depending on the heat setting and intensity of use. Monitoring the fuel level periodically is crucial to avoid running out mid-meal.

Having extra canisters on hand is a wise idea for longer camping trips or cooking sessions. Remember to always follow safety guidelines when handling and storing butane canisters for a smooth and secure outdoor cooking experience.

Are There Any Specific Safety Precautions to Follow When Using These Stoves?

When using these stoves, it's important to prioritize safety. Always guarantee proper ventilation to prevent carbon monoxide buildup.

Additionally, keep flammable materials away from the stove, and never leave it unattended while in use.

Regularly inspect the stove for any damage or leaks. Finally, follow the manufacturer's instructions carefully to avoid accidents.
